Abijah Anderson, b. about 1837 in Tennessee, d. in 1897 in Kentucky. He attended Carson-Newman College, Jefferson City, TN, which closed, due to the Civil War, in his senior year. He was possibly a photographer in the army during the Civil War (www.geocities.com....ction.html)

Renowned photographer Lee Miller was in the right places at the right time during World War II. She photographed London during the blitz, Normandy after D-Day, and the liberation of Dachau concentration camp (www.csmonitor.com/books)
